Transaction 3637ed3febfc36b6f04eaf440edaf68b0feb45d3cc1c1d572e7452f152be210b

1 Input
2 Outputs
  • 3637ed3febfc36b6f04eaf440edaf68b0feb45d3cc1c1d572e7452f152be210b:0
  • value  74022
    address  38afEXtJTJjkAfDyMRDS3UM5KrdMXqh4fX
  • 3637ed3febfc36b6f04eaf440edaf68b0feb45d3cc1c1d572e7452f152be210b:1
  • value  3909606
    address  17ajg4eYun7XPggU4gf9i4T5zsHGAD3QjX